How Does Dazed and Confused Fred Fit into the Story?

Fred O'Bannion, as the main antagonist, plays a pretty specific part in the overall story of Dazed and Confused. His actions, you know, are often focused on the incoming freshmen, particularly the boys. He is, basically, one of the older students who takes part in the hazing rituals, which involve chasing down and paddling the younger kids. This behavior, you could say, creates a certain amount of tension and fear for the freshmen, making their last day of middle school, and first day of high school, a bit more intense than it might otherwise be.

His presence helps to show the different power dynamics that exist within the school's social groups. The way he interacts with the younger students, you know, highlights the hierarchy that exists among the different grades. He is, perhaps, a representation of the more aggressive or traditional side of the senior class. His role, in a way, is to challenge the new students, to put them through a sort of rite of passage, even if it is a rough one. This contributes to the overall sense of realism in the film, as such behaviors were, arguably, not uncommon in schools during that time.

One of his more memorable lines, you know, comes during a scene involving a pool table. He delivers the line, "You are an embarrassment to the game of pool," which, basically, captures his somewhat arrogant and domineering personality. This line, in some respects, shows his attitude towards those he considers beneath him or those who do not meet his standards.
